Virtual tumor predicts response to liver cancer immunotherapy

Researchers at Johns Hopkins have developed a computational model that simulates tumor behavior to predict patient response to liver cancer immunotherapy. This tool aims to help physicians identify the most effective treatment combinations for hepatocellular carcinoma.
